Penerapan Hygiene Sanitasi dan Keselamatan Kerja Pada UMKM Setan Bali

Ni Wayan Nursini, Ida Bagus Agung Yogeswara, Putu Wida Gunawan, I Gusti Ayu Wita Kusumawati

Abstract


UMKM Sele Tangi (Setan) Bali merupakan industri rumah tangga yang mengolah klepon berbahan dasar ubi ungu. Pengolahan yang tidak higienis dan sanitasi tempat produksi berpengaruh pada kualitas produk yang dihasilkan. Tujuan dilaksanakan PkM pada UMKM Setan Bali adalah untuk menerapkan personal hygiene dan peralatan, sanitasi tempat produksi serta keselamatan kerja para pekerja. Metode PkM dilakukan dengan cara ceramah, diskusi dan praktek mengenai cara mencuci tangan yang baik dan benar, penggunaan penutup kepala, sarung tangan dan masker saat melakukan produksi, hygiene peralatan, sanitasi tempat produksi dan keselamatan kerja serta cara melakukan penanggulangan terhadap kecelakaan kerja. Hasil pre-test menunjukkan bahwa pengetahuan mitra terhadap personal hygiene, hygiene peralatan, sanitasi tempat produksi dan keselamatan kerja yaitu masing-masing sebesar 73,81%; 71,43%; 71,43%; dan 85,71%. Sedangkan hasil post-test menunjukkan bahwa setelah pelatihan, pengetahuan mitra terhadap personal hygiene, hygiene peralatan, sanitasi tempat produksi dan keselamatan kerja meningkat masing-masing menjadi 95,24%; 85,71%; 100%; dan 100%. Dengan menerapkan hygiene, sanitasi dan keselamatan kerja pada proses produksi dapat meningkatkan mutu produk yang dihasilkan.
